The University of Kansas is hiring student tutors for its Youth Educational Services (YES) Tutoring program. These tutors will provide essential tutoring services to K-12 students in local Lawrence public schools, ensuring that they receive the support they need before, during, and after school.
Applicants should be KU students, preferably with experience working with children, and must maintain a minimum 2.5 GPA while enrolled in at least six credit hours. This is an hourly position, and remote work is not typically available.

During the semester term of the appointment, the student hourly must be enrolled in no fewer than 6 credit hours. For summer periods the student hourly must: (1) have been enrolled in no less than 6 hours in the past spring semester or (2) be pre‑enrolled in the upcoming fall semester in no less than 6 hours or (3) be enrolled in summer session or (4) be admitted to study in the upcoming fall semester. Student Hourlies may be undergraduate or graduate students. (Exceptions granted for GRA/GTA/GA appointments DO NOT apply to Student Hourly appointments).
